Air Jordan 3 'Laser' Revealed for August

Jordan Brand is reviving one of its most creative design concepts with the return of the Air Jordan 3 'Laser.' Originally popularized during the mid-2000s, the Laser series transformed classic Air Jordan silhouettes into storytelling canvases through intricate laser-etched graphics. Rather than relying solely on color, the collection celebrated Michael Jordan's legacy with hidden artwork and meaningful references embedded throughout the upper. More than two decades later, the concept returns on the Air Jordan 3 with a fresh interpretation of that iconic design language.

The upcoming release features an off-white leather upper covered in detailed laser engravings that pay tribute to milestones from Jordan's life both on and off the court. Each section of the shoe reveals subtle references, encouraging fans to discover new details with every closer look.

Among the most recognizable graphics is the "M AIR J" license plate, referencing the personalized plate found on Michael Jordan's black Ferrari 512 TR, a car he famously drove throughout the Chicago Bulls' championship dynasty in the early 1990s. Additional engravings include a golf cart, the iconic "23" entrance gate from Jordan's former Chicago-area estate, and "Sandy Bros.," a tribute to Nike designers Eric and Chad Sandy, longtime contributors to Jordan Brand's creative legacy.

The premium construction is completed with rich Palomino suede overlays around the toe and heel, metallic silver eyelets, and classic Nike Air branding on the heel, combining heritage details with the model's distinctive storytelling aesthetic.

The release also pays homage to one of Jordan Brand's rarest player exclusives. In 2003, Mark Smith created a one-of-one Air Jordan 3 'Laser' for Michael Jordan's 40th birthday, introducing the laser-etched concept before it later expanded into a full collection. While this 2026 version isn't a direct recreation, it draws clear inspiration from that celebrated piece of Jordan Brand history.

Its arrival also signals a broader return of the Laser era, with Jordan Brand expected to bring back both the black and white Air Jordan 4 'Laser' colorways in 2027. For longtime collectors, the Air Jordan 3 'Laser' represents more than another retro—it celebrates one of the brand's most artistic and collectible design periods. The Air Jordan 3 'Laser' releases on August 22, 2026, and will retail for $230 USD.
